Steps to Manage Payments Safely
1. Choose a secure payment gateway. Ensure the software integrates with reputable payment processors that comply with security standards like PCI DSS.
2. Enable encryption and two-factor authentication. Protect access to payment information by activating these security features within the software.
3. Regularly update your software. Keep your property management system and payment plugins up to date to patch vulnerabilities.
4. Monitor transactions frequently. Review payment logs and reports to detect any suspicious activity early.
